
Business Experience & Results
Brent Valle is a three-time technology founder who has built, scaled, and exited multiple companies while creating impact far beyond the boardroom. His entrepreneurial journey began in 2005 with the acquisition of a struggling business, The PC Company, for $240,000. Within just two years, he transformed it into a thriving venture and sold it to international firm I.T. Xchange for $1.1 million.
That same year, Brent began sharing his expertise by facilitating marketing diploma subjects at Holmesglen Institute TAFE, laying the groundwork for his future as a mentor and coach. In 2011, he co-founded NGage Technology Group, where he served as employee number one. Over the next five years, NGage became one of Australia’s fastest-growing technology companies, reaching $27 million in revenue by its fifth year. In 2017, Brent successfully negotiated its sale to a publicly listed ASX technology company in a multi-million-dollar deal.
Never one to rest on his achievements, Brent launched Future Phase in 2017, a venture designed to transform the results and lives of corporate teams and entrepreneurs. That same year, he became a foundation partner of the LifeChanger Foundation, investing $45,000 and co-leading its official launch, raising over $100,000 in fundraising. Brent also extended his passion for surfing and community by acquiring Bells Surf Wax, launching new products at the iconic Rip Curl Pro, and creating A New Wave surf and wellness event, which raised $10,000 for mental health charity LIVIN.
Through Future Phase, Brent pioneered leadership and performance programs such as Future X (earning a 100% referral score from ASX-listed clients) and Thrive, an entrepreneur mentoring program. In 2020, he returned to his roots in technology by founding Techtify, a company built on the ethos of “Technology Together,” continuing his mission to align technology, business, and human potential.
Certifications & Qualifications
Brent has always complemented his hands-on entrepreneurial experience with a strong foundation in education and personal development. After completing his Victorian Certificate of Education in 1994, he pursued higher learning across business and human performance. His credentials include an Advanced Diploma in International Business (2005), a Graduate Certificate in Marketing (2006), and a Diploma in Coaching (Executive, Life & Leadership) (2009).
Further sharpening his expertise, he became a Certified NLP Performance Coach and Workshop Facilitator in 2010, and in 2017 gained recognition as a FORTH Innovation Method Certified Facilitator. Awards & Recognition
Brent’s results have not gone unnoticed. Under his leadership, NGage Technology earned a spot in the CRN Fast 50 Awards in 2013 and was later inducted as a CRN All Star for Life in 2017. In 2015, NGage placed 5th in BRW’s Fast 100, ranking it among the fastest-growing companies across all industries in Australia.
